2008 BMW M5 vs. 2012 Mazda 6

To start off, 2012 Mazda 6 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 BMW M5.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 BMW M5 would be higher. At 4,999 cc (10 cylinders), 2008 BMW M5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 BMW M5 (500 HP @ 7750 RPM) has 228 more horse power than 2012 Mazda 6. (272 HP @ 6250 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 BMW M5 should accelerate faster than 2012 Mazda 6.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 BMW M5 weights approximately 209 kg more than 2012 Mazda 6.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 BMW M5 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2008 BMW M5.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2012 Mazda 6,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 BMW M5 (520 Nm @ 6100 RPM) has 156 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Mazda 6. (364 Nm @ 4250 RPM). This means 2008 BMW M5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Mazda 6.
